**The difference you will make as a Support Assistant**

You will be key in the day-to-day running of one of our supported housing services. We don’t run care homes, so there’s no need to provide personal care. The priority in your role includes the safety and wellbeing of everyone in our accommodation, including our customers.

Working with people who have a range of needs, you could be doing any number of things. From supporting customers in conversations with calls from their GP, Social Services, or Benefits teams - to dealing with the emergency services including the Police and Ambulance, when the need arises.

You’ll log all incidents to make sure we have an accurate record of events. And when a customer leaves, you will clean and prepare their room, ready for the next occupant.

**Role Profile**

We use Psychologically Informed approaches and Trauma Informed Care principles to support our customers to make positive choices, develop new ways of thinking and take steps towards independence, by:

- Assisting in the planning and delivery of a range of personalised support and move-on plans
- Understanding the risk management process and assisting the team to organise and undertake regular reviews of support and risk
- Inspiring and motivating customers to meet agreed outcomes and develop life skills
- Assisting customers with day-to-day support and tenancy-related matters
- Assisting the team to identify and promote opportunities for employment, education and training and support customers to access them
- Signposting customers to appropriate external support services, such as food banks and other community resources
- Supporting customers to be ‘tenancy ready’, enabling successful move on
- Supporting customers to be financially independent through budgeting plans and maximising income
- Supporting and monitoring customers’ healthcare needs, ensuring appropriate contact with healthcare professionals
- Empowering customers to move towards self-management of their medication by following Riverside’s medication procedure
- Maintaining and updating clear, accurate and strengths-based records on the appropriate digital platform
- Assisting in the promotion of customer involvement and consultation
- Assisting with the delivery of a range of group work sessions
